99 Chrysler LHS - Infinity I System
Hi guys-
I have a 99 LHS with the infinity I sound system. The two 2.5 inch coaxial speakers in the lower corners of the front door windows are in need of replacement. The problem is I cannot locate a pair of 2.5 inch speakers anywhere. Is there anywhere to search other than the dealership? I tried looking at crutchfield, but had no luck. They are suggesting using 3.5 inch speakers in that spot, which I do not think will fit. Has anyone replaced these in the past and have tips? Where to purchase the speakers, and how to remove the covers? Thanks, Bob |

My sebring had those in the dash. I ended up taking the midrange speakers
from a pair of 6x9 pioneers and removing the capacitor to make it a full range speaker. The size was a little over 2.5 inches but a tiny bit of grinding on opposite edges and they were able to be hotglued into the factory grilles. Beats the hell out of the $200 the dealer wanted and they sound better. 3.5's will definietly not fit at all.
